1) Battery Technology: Lithium vs Other Battery Types
Battery choice affects daily convenience more than most buyers expect. Many Voyager configurations highlight lithium power as a core identity, which can be appealing if you want consistent output and less day-to-day battery maintenance. Tara also commonly emphasizes lithium as part of a premium component story, but the exact battery type can still vary by trim and dealer build.
Buyer tip: Ask the dealer to confirm the battery brand/spec, charger type, warranty coverage, and expected charging routine. A great cart can feel average if the battery and charger pairing isn’t properly matched.
2) Build and Frame: Aluminum vs Steel
One of the most talked-about distinctions is frame material. Voyager is often associated with aluminum-frame designs in some lines, while many carts in the broader market use steel frames. Aluminum can help with corrosion resistance and weight considerations, while steel can deliver a classic “heavy-duty” feel depending on design and protection coatings.
What to check: Don’t judge only by material. Inspect weld quality, protective coatings, underbody shielding, and how the cart behaves over bumps. Frame design and assembly consistency matter as much as raw material choice.
3) Voltage and Power Delivery (Example: 72V Systems)
Voyager marketing often references higher-voltage systems (commonly 72V), which can correlate with strong electric response and efficient power delivery when engineered well. Tara’s performance emphasis usually highlights a modern drive system and a refined “premium cruiser” experience rather than focusing solely on voltage numbers.
Bottom line: Higher voltage can be a plus, but real-world performance depends on the full drivetrain setup—controller tuning, motor type, gearing, tire size, and overall vehicle weight.

Head-to-Head Checklist (Use This Before You Buy)
- Test drive on the same route: turns, bumps, and stops. Pay attention to steering comfort and brake confidence.
- Confirm the battery package: lithium vs other types, battery brand/spec, charger compatibility, and warranty terms.
- Inspect the underside: look for clean cable routing, protected lines, and solid fastener work.
- Compare frame protection: coatings, corrosion prevention, and build quality—not just aluminum vs steel.
- Ask about service logistics: who services it, parts lead times, and typical turnaround for warranty claims.
- Compare “must-have” features: screen size, lighting, storage, seating, and any convenience add-ons.
